Output e596b7adbd8374cd1558e8d94cdd6815171745e4f8dca0f328db5e5bbf2e8cda:0

value
6432268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91fb46a68905de322e4caa48e52d668978f93cf8 OP_EQUAL
address
3EztvKXXVhXnRaqkDfygQUR4sW5WpEiCxg
transaction
e596b7adbd8374cd1558e8d94cdd6815171745e4f8dca0f328db5e5bbf2e8cda
confirmations
36804
spent
true